We are launching a new Language Arts Unit called "Going the Distance." In this unit we will explore ideas of bias, prejudice, racism and how people have overcome these obstacles.  We will be reading both a futuristic novel that deals with bias and racism based upon social class and we will also be reading a novel that delves into residential schools and First Nations Culture.

We will also be launching a new Science Unit on Forces and Simple Machines.  There will be a cool science project to go along with this unit!

We started Monday this week with a new math unit on fractions and decimals.  This is a difficult concept for some students so I encourage all families to incorporate fractions into as many daily activities as you can.  One of the best ways to work fractions into "home" activities is cooking; think measuring cups!  How many 1/2 cups make a whole cup, how many 1/4 cups make a whole etc.  Thanks! We are currently working with "equivalent fractions" and "mixed numbers."
